What this means

These status codes mean the trademark application is abandoned and no longer pending. Common reasons include missing an Office Action response (600), filing without a valid basis (602), express abandonment by the applicant (604), or failure to respond to an examiner's inquiry (618). Revival may be possible in limited circumstances. If abandonment was unintentional, consult counsel about a petition to revive. Otherwise file a new application if protection is still needed.

Goods and services

ClassDescriptionStatusFirst use
041Educational training in relation to designing, building, publishing, maintaining and hosting websites; The organisation of conferences, seminars, webinars, motivational speaking and classes in relation to designing, building, publishing, maintaining and hosting websitesACTIVE
